NZDUSD – Indecisive retail forex trader sentiment leaves us with a mixed short-term trading bias on the New Zealand Dollar. A continued hold above pivotal support surrounding $0.6500-0.6550 suggests that the pair may yet trade higher.
It is nonetheless important to note that broader US Dollar rallies may keep a lid on any near-term NZD/USD strength. Ideally we would see a much stronger shift in crowd sentiment before turning in favor of buying into NZD strength.
